PHP连接MySQL进行增、删、改、查操作


Posted in PHP onFebruary 19, 2017

话不多说,请看代码:

<table width="100%" border="1" cellpadding="0" cellspacing="0">
<tr>
<td>代号</td>
<td>姓名</td>
<td>性别</td>
<td>民族</td>
<td>生日</td>
</tr>
<?php
1.造一个mysqli对象,造连接对象
$db = new MySQLi("localhost","用户名","密码","数据库名");
2.准备一条SQL语句
$sql = "select * from info";
3.执行SQL语句,如果是查询语句,成功返回结果集对象
$reslut = $db->query($sql);
4.判断返回是否执行成功
if($reslut)
{
while($attr = $reslut->fetch_row())
{
echo "<tr>
<td>{$attr[0]}</td>
<td>{$attr[1]}</td>
<td>{$attr[2]}</td>
<td>{$attr[3]}</td>
<td>{$attr[4]}</td>
</tr>";
}
}
?>
</table>

fetch_all()              返回全部数组

fetch_row()            返回索引数组

fetch_assoc()         返回关联数组

fetch_object()        返回对象

fetch_array()          返回的数组既有索引的,又有关联的

数据库的删除,增加,修改操作

<?php
//造连接对象
$db = new MySQLi("localhost","用户名","密码","数据库名");
//准备SQL语句
$sql = "delete from info where code='p004'";    删
//$sql = "insert course values"       增
//$sql = "update 表名 set 字段=信息 where 字段=信息"   改
//执行SQL语句
$r = $db->query($sql);
if($r)
{
echo "执行成功";
}
else
{
echo "执行失败";
}
?>

以上就是本文的全部内容,希望本文的内容对大家的学习或者工作能带来一定的帮助,同时也希望多多支持三水点靠木!

PHP 相关文章推荐
PHP版网站缓存加快打开速度的方法分享
Jun 03 PHP
邮箱正则表达式实现代码(针对php)
Jun 21 PHP
解析PHP将对象转换成数组的方法(兼容多维数组类型)
Jun 21 PHP
PHP中抽象类、接口的区别与选择分析
Mar 29 PHP
一波PHP中cURL库的常见用法代码示例
May 06 PHP
php中输出json对象的值(实现方法)
Mar 07 PHP
PHP使用curl_multi_select解决curl_multi网页假死问题的方法
Aug 15 PHP
PHP Laravel中的Trait使用方法
Jan 20 PHP
PHP7内核之Reference详解
Mar 14 PHP
php开发最强大的IDE编辑的phpstorm 2020.2配置Xdebug调试的详细教程
Aug 17 PHP
ThinkPHP5分页paginate代码实例解析
Nov 10 PHP
php实现简单四则运算器
Nov 29 PHP
PHP进程通信基础之信号量与共享内存通信
Feb 19 #PHP
PHP进程通信基础之信号
Feb 19 #PHP
PHP 信号管理知识整理汇总
Feb 19 #PHP
php 三大特点:封装,继承,多态
Feb 19 #PHP
PHP实现大数(浮点数)取余的方法
Feb 18 #PHP
Zend Framework基于Command命令行建立ZF项目的方法
Feb 18 #PHP
完美解决php 导出excle的.csv格式的数据时乱码问题
Feb 18 #PHP
You might like
php 文章调用类代码
2011/08/11 PHP
php addslashes及其他清除空格的方法是不安全的
2012/01/25 PHP
PHP获取文件行数的方法
2015/06/10 PHP
转一个日期输入控件,支持FF
2007/04/27 Javascript
给Function做的OOP扩展
2009/05/07 Javascript
JavaScript实现复制功能各浏览器支持情况实测
2013/07/18 Javascript
javascript获取元素CSS样式代码示例
2013/11/28 Javascript
JS实现点击按钮控制Div变宽、增高及调整背景色的方法
2015/08/05 Javascript
使用vue.js制作分页组件
2016/06/27 Javascript
移动端日期插件Mobiscroll.js使用详解
2016/12/19 Javascript
JavaScript实现简单的星星评分效果
2017/05/18 Javascript
vue.js选中动态绑定的radio的指定项
2017/06/02 Javascript
vue项目引入Iconfont图标库的教程图解
2018/10/24 Javascript
VUE单页面切换动画代码(全网最好的切换效果)
2019/10/31 Javascript
python 提取文件的小程序
2009/07/29 Python
py2exe 编译ico图标的代码
2013/03/08 Python
pyttsx3实现中文文字转语音的方法
2018/12/24 Python
Pandas统计重复的列里面的值方法
2019/01/30 Python
详解Python可视化神器Yellowbrick使用
2019/11/11 Python
python实现连续变量最优分箱详解--CART算法
2019/11/22 Python
简单了解Django ORM常用字段类型及参数配置
2020/01/07 Python
openCV提取图像中的矩形区域
2020/07/21 Python
解决Ubuntu18中的pycharm不能调用tensorflow-gpu的问题
2020/09/17 Python
Python3 用matplotlib绘制sigmoid函数的案例
2020/12/11 Python
jupyter notebook指定启动目录的方法
2021/03/02 Python
用CSS3将你的设计带入下个高度
2009/08/08 HTML / CSS
CSS3 Media Queries详细介绍和使用实例
2014/05/08 HTML / CSS
CSS3实现多背景模拟动态边框的效果
2016/11/08 HTML / CSS
html5中canvas学习笔记2-判断浏览器是否支持canvas
2013/01/06 HTML / CSS
中式结婚主持词
2014/03/14 职场文书
学校督导评估方案
2014/06/10 职场文书
路政管理求职信
2014/06/18 职场文书
学校运动会广播稿100条
2014/09/14 职场文书
2015年师德师风承诺书
2015/01/22 职场文书
python 模拟在天空中放风筝的示例代码
2021/04/21 Python
基于Redis的List实现特价商品列表功能
2021/08/30 Redis